Cette application est conçue pour être utilisée auprès de personnes présentant un trouble de la lecture acquis suite à un accident vasculaire cérébral, un traumatisme crânien ou un trouble développemental. Elle peut aussi servir aux enfants présentant des besoins spécifiques. Il s’agit d’un livre numérique d’exercices de compréhension de la lecture ordonné sur le plan sémantique. De plus, vous pouvez créer vos propres items dans chaque module.
Domaines travaillés : compréhension du langage écrit, attention, résolution de problèmes, traitement visuel, raisonnement.
Pathologie : aphasie, alexie, démence type Alzheimer, démences, troubles de la communication, traumatisme crânio-encéphalique, grands-débutants, trouble spécifique des apprentissages, troubles du spectre autistique, étudiants étrangers.
Caractéristiques :
*4 modes comprenant plus de 450 items chacun, soit plus de 1800 items de compréhension de l’écrit.
1) Appariements d’expressions
2) Appariements de phrases
3) Complétions d’expressions
4) Complétions de phrases
* Des centaines de photographies détaillées sélectionnées par une orthophoniste et utilisées dans les deux modules d’appariements.
* Des distracteurs soigneusement conçus obligent le lecteur à lire attentivement.
*Une interface conviviale avec des icônes claires qui permet une utilisation autonome de l’application.
* Une notation automatique permettant une traçabilité aisée des progrès.
* Les mauvaises réponses déjà sélectionnées sont grisées.
* Les flèches d’avance et de recul autorisent une grande souplesse d’utilisation : il est possible de passer des items pour y revenir plus tard et de consulter des items déjà effectués pour échanger à leur sujet.
* Un mode enfant retire toute référence à des thématiques d’adultes et désactivent les liens hors application.
* Le bon appariement a toujours lieu sous les yeux de l’utilisateur, ce qui renforce la bonne réponse.
* Possibilité d’éliminer les mots pour ne conserver que les images et vice versa.
* Limiter les réponses à 2, 3 ou 4 propositions maximum.
* Les résultats peuvent être envoyés par courriel au thérapeute : les patients le tiennent informé des progrès accomplis et les thérapeutes peuvent s’envoyer mutuellement les rapports, ce qui entraîne un gain de temps de rédaction appréciable.

I've used this in my classroom for students with autism. One of the things I like best about the app is phrase matching, where students match a photo to the words describing it. This is great for working on reading comprehension with my students. I especially like that some of the words are similar so students really have to descriminate, such as if it's a "slippery snake" or a "sugary snake", or choosing the correct color as well as the item. I'd love to have a simpler option where "snake" was the answer, for students who don't read as many words yet. Love that one of the categories is body parts! I see a lot of potential with the fact that you can add your own categories and photos to work on custom vocabulary. It would be great if you could access the photos already in the application for this, so that you didn't need to take a photo of each item you wanted to add in order to use a custom list, but I love that you can set up your own list. Another "wish for" item would be the option to have the data tell me which items a student missed, rather than just percentage of accuracy, but these are just wish items that would make a great app even better.

The NamingApp and the ReadingApp have similar user interfaces which is great. For my wife suffering from aphasia and apraxia, it was a natural step to use the ReadingApp to move from saying single words to saying phrases and complete sentences. The ReadingApp has options of phrase matching and completion and sentence matching and completion. My wife likes to use the sentence completion feature and then speak the completed sentence. Unlike the NamingApp, the ReadingApp does not have the facility to speak the completed sentence so I or someone else has to work with her. It would be great if Tactus added this or created another app that speaks sentences.
